T&T Hair and Beauty Tradeshow 2013

Who doesn't love a tradeshow? This is my second year at the T&T Hair and Beauty Tradeshow at the Capital Plaza. It was once again a 3 day event (May 4-6th) and unlike last year when I popped in on the Saturday, I attended on the Sunday instead. Oh boy was it ever so busy with the room filled with patrons that it was just a bit difficult to properly scan each booth. Nevertheless I did get a chance to capture some wonderful moments that I would love to share with you. Let's begin :)


Let's start with the HAIR! Wow this show had a large focus on hair products staying true to the name of the show. At the time I was attending I was lucky enough to see some of the contestants in the hair competition. The designs were detailed and really showcased the talents of the hairstylists. I was in love with these pin curls :)


Now onto the hair products! While there were many booths and products to choose from; these were some of my favorites since these are new to our local market. Let's meet Keratherapy! First time in Trinidad!!!


The Keratherapy experts were on hand to give wonderful demonstrations on their products which unfortunately I missed :(but be sure to check out their facebook page and hair and beauty show in trinidad album for more exciting pictures). 
What I loved about Keratherapy is their amazing technology of combining keratin, silk amino and fruit acids to give your hair shine, strength and smoothness.
And for your local folks, be sure to check out authorised distributor: Fifth Avenue Express Salon and Beauty Supplies to get your hands and hair on Keratherapy :)

Moroccan and argan oils seems to also be in focus this year. Meet the new Suave Moroccan Infusion distributed by Unilever. This line is infused with the authentic Moroccan oil that gives you instant shine and softness. The gorgeous Unilever ladies at this booth were kind enough to share some samples on the spot and I did notice the immediate change to my slightly dry coloured ends.


The Tresemme' booth was beautifully displayed and on the spot demonstrations assisted patrons with styling tips and tricks. Some of my favorite Tresemme products are from the naturals line.


And since I'm a nail art fanatic, I could spot this booth a mile away with the interesting nail strips and stencils.


Lash extensions anyone? Meet MyLash Canada; at the show it was possible to get a full set of lash extensions for $TT300. And they carry a range of makeup as well. 


Did I save the best for last? You decide! Seeing Palladio makeup up close and personal was indeed exciting to me. This brand has all natural herbal makeup infused with ingredients such as aloe vera, ginseng, gingko biloba and green tea! Some of their popular product includes their rice powder; known for its oil absorbing properties, great for setting makeup and silky finish. This brand is being distributed in T&T by PRD Holdings Ltd.





What an exciting day with wonderful new discoveries on products available to the average consumer. I can't wait to see what else is in store for me next year. See you next year!
